The skill of cask handling, like general cellar management, has been sadly long lost in this country from decades of publicans only having to deal with kegs. If a cask is cloudy it's generally because it hasn't been given time to settle.

I was in a city centre pub recently and felt the need to intervene as the barman was making a hash of my pint with the beer engine (not the B&C, btw). I gave him a few pointers and he replied "I'm useless with the cask beer".

The thing is that once you understand what's going on, and what you can and can't do, it's very straight-forward. A teeny bit of staff training would cure the problem.
